D’Mani Mellor has become the latest player to leave Manchester United on loan.
The young striker has joined Salford City on a season long deal.
Mellor, 20, came through the ranks at United but suffered an ACL injury in March 2020.
He has now made his comeback from injury and was recently spotted training with the first team.

Delighted to have him
Salford boss Gary Bowyer told the club website how thrilled he is with his new addition.
“Firstly, a big thank you to all at Manchester United, this loan once again strengthens the relationship between the two clubs with Di’Shon Bernard having a successful loan here last season.
“We are delighted that D’Mani has agreed to join us on loan and he gives us another attacking option.
“He is an exciting player. with an incredible work rate who was very excited to come and join us.”
Mellor also sent a message to his new club’s fans after his arrival was confirmed, and it’s clear he shares Bowyer’s enthusiasm.
Class of ’92 relationship bearing fruit
Of course six members of the ‘Class of ’92’ are owners at Salford, and it’s not the first time United have sent a loan player there.
Last season, Di’Shon Bernard went to the League 2 club. He impressed and on the back of that, he is now in the Championship with Hull.
If Mellor can have that progression, he’ll be thrilled, especially coming from where he was with his serious injury last year.
He went straight into the Salford squad for today’s 3-0 win against Newport and came on as a substitute in second half stoppage time.
